swarm 安装ES-8.6.0 (三)
#启动服务
docker stack deploy -c docker-compose.yaml elastic
#停止程序并删除服务
docker service rm elastic_es1 elastic_es2 elastic_es3 elastic_kibana
#查看日志
docker service logs elastic_es1
#集群配置xpack,进入一个es节点
需要先关闭认证
xpack.security.enabled: false
xpack.security.transport.ssl.enabled: false
一路回车完成后,再执行
bin/elasticsearch-certutil cert --ca elastic-stack-ca.p12
一路回车
#在宿主机拷贝文件到 /data/es/config/certs目录,各es节点需要
docker cp 632ef510b563:/usr/share/elasticsearch/elastic-certificates.p12 certs
docker cp 632ef510b563:/usr/share/elasticsearch/elastic-stack-ca.p12 certs
配置权限
chmod -R 755 /data/es/config/certs*
#配置密码
需要先开启xpack,否则报错,进入一个节点
bin/elasticsearch-setup-passwords interactive
密码:Meng